The social networking giant Facebook has announced that it would stop third-party app invites which is a part of early facebook during their blooming period.
Earlier many third-party apps gained popularity by app invites. You will always get app invites or game notification on your Facebook feeds. Even some login games or apps via facebook username to get more in-game points and also to show friends about the new app or game.
This App notification on Facebook has grown with us. Nowadays the majority of apps request for a login via Facebook and Google. It has always been a part of our days. Now Facebook is slowly getting these things out. The Developer page clearly shows that this policy will get completely implemented by Feb 6, 2018.
The next feature facebook gonna depreciate is the “Like” feature which currently any user can like any app or Game page via the app or the Game. But hereafter facebook is going to tighten the space as the “Like” feature is going to work only on Facebook App only. So if you want to like any game page or app support page, you should use the Facebook app or web to access the specific page.
The next thing is edge.create an edge.remove JS SDK events will not be accessible and you can use webhooks to view your page likes count. Likewise, Comment mirroring will be accessed only for next 90 days and it will also not be available for pages who have not enabled it previously. Send button will no longer be available to share a link and Lots more.
